Bung feels Sabah sidelined in new Cabinet line-up


KOTA KINABALU: Sabah Deputy Chief Minister Datuk Seri Bung Moktar Radin (pic) feels that the state is under-represented in Prime Minister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im’s Federal Government despite the support of almost all of Sabah MPs in the administration.

He added that the two ministers’ posts given to Pakatan Harapan’s component parties Upko and Gabungan Rakyat Sabah (GRS) were not reflective of the support given to the unity government by 24 out of the 25 Sabah MPs.
